One of the absolute gems of the Maldives is the Anantara Kihavah Maldives Villas. This resort is situated on Kihavah Huravalhi Island in the Baa Atoll. The villas here are simply breathtaking, ranging from spacious beachfront hideaways with private pools to over-water villas that provide uninterrupted views of the ocean. Guests can indulge in a range of activities, such as snorkeling in the coral-rich house reef, dining at underwater restaurants, and experiencing the unique spa treatments in the resort’s over-water spa.
Another outstanding resort is the Gili Lankanfushi Maldives. Located in North Male Atoll, this resort is famous for its eco-friendly philosophy and idyllic setting. The highlight of Gili Lankanfushi Maldives is undoubtedly the over-water villas, which offer the utmost luxury and privacy. Each villa has direct access to the turquoise lagoon, allowing guests to immerse themselves in the stunning aquatic surroundings. Additionally, the resort offers a range of unique dining experiences, including a dinner in a treetop nest or a private barbecue on a secluded sandbank.
For those looking for an ultra-luxurious and exclusive retreat, the Velaa Private Island resort is the perfect choice. Situated on its private island in Noonu Atoll, Velaa Private Island offers unparalleled privacy and exemplary service. The villas are exquisitely designed, featuring their own pools, private beaches, and breathtaking ocean views. Guests can enjoy a range of unique experiences, from a round of golf on the island’s golf course to a rejuvenating spa treatment in one of the resort’s over-water spa pavilions.
If you are seeking a resort that harmoniously blends luxury with nature, then Soneva Jani is the perfect destination for you. Located on the Medhufaru Island in Noonu Atoll, Soneva Jani is renowned for its spacious over-water villas, each with a private pool and direct access to the lagoon. The resort embraces a sustainable ethos, providing guests with organic produce, beautiful gardens, and an observatory for stargazing. Additionally, Soneva Jani offers an array of thrilling experiences, including visiting the nearby Manta Trust, a non-profit organization dedicated to researching and conserving manta rays.
Last but not least, we have the Six Senses Laamu, a resort known for its sustainable practices and stunning natural surroundings. Located in the Laamu Atoll, Six Senses Laamu offers both beachfront and over-water villas, all with private pools and direct access to the turquoise lagoon. The resort’s emphasis on a barefoot luxury experience is evident in its laid-back yet refined atmosphere that seamlessly blends with the pristine environment. Guests can participate in a range of activities, from diving and snorkeling to cooking classes and spa therapies.
